Do Tech - For Good
Inspirational Micro-Talks for Code Enthusiasts
Join us November 4th, 2018 with local tech innovators and organizations at “Do Tech - For Good” as they present micro-talks about using tech skills such as coding, development, and design for Indy non-profit organizations. Observe as professionals explain how volunteering for the non-profit community provides opportunities to develop new skills and build projects that can be featured in a competitive portfolio. All skill levels are encouraged to attend, and networking opportunities will be provided.
Stop by the Networking Room to communicate with Partner organizations that will answer questions about involvement and non-profits. Members of the Central Library’s Code Café team will also be present to provide information about free coding opportunities for beginners.
